I went in the Eye! by onebaygirl

When I was in London last year, I didn’t go in the Eye because I figured it was too expensive. BUT, when an unexpected trip to London came up, I decided this was something I want to do. I mean, how many times will I be in London? Not only did we go, we paid extra for the express tickets. We didn’t want a once in a lifetime experience to be a bad one. The regular ticket line was sooo long, and we were jetlagged and hungry. So, the express tickets were what we wanted, and I don’t regret it. We went right up into the Eye, got some great views and pictures of London, and then it was all over after about a half hour. It’s really worth doing maybe just once unless you’re really afraid of heights.

Untitled by runintherain

I’ve only been once, quite a while ago but it is definitely worth it. Try to research what time sunset is and plan it so that you’re at the top of the Eye when it happens. You watch as the sun sets over London – it’s pretty remarkable.

A new perspective at night by daydreamer

I visited the London Eye in the evening not long after it opened – not by design, we just left it a bit late to book our advance tickets! The first surprise is that the Eye doesn’t actually pause to let people get into the pods – it’s moving so slowly that there’s time for you to get on whilst it rotates.

The second was how completely different my hometown looks at night. There were the obvious viewpoints – the Canary Wharf tower twinkling in the east, the beautifully lit Houses of Parliament and Big Ben below. We were puzzling over an imposing building further downstream on the opposite bank and decided that it must be a previously unknown museum. It turned out to be Charing Cross station. Oops!
